#Overview: The Economic Lifeline of Coimbatore Freight

Stretching 28 kilometers from Neelambur on Avinashi Road (NH 544) to Madukkarai on Palakkad Road (NH 544), the Coimbatore L&T Bypass Road is the primary industrial and freight bypass corridor of Western Tamil Nadu.

By allowing heavy vehicles to bypass inner city traffic, this highway corridor has attracted massive logistics parks, container freight stations, industrial warehouses, and commercial highway plazas.

#Key Junctions & Commercial Growth Clusters

Neelambur Junction: High-value commercial hub connecting to Coimbatore Airport, KMCH, and Kathir College.

Trichy Road Junction (Singanallur/Chinthamanipudur): Logistics hub connecting to Sulur air corridor and Tirupur garment cluster.

Eachanari / Chettipalayam Junction: Educational and industrial corridor link.

Madukkarai Junction: Cement manufacturing hub connecting towards Palakkad and Kerala border.

#Commercial Land, Warehousing & Property Rates

Property along the L&T Bypass consists mainly of multi-acre commercial land parcels suitable for logistics hubs, fuel stations, automobile showrooms, and industrial godowns.

Residential plotting layouts in adjoining pockets (such as Pattanam, Chinthamanipudur, and Malumichampatti) provide accessible housing plots for industrial workers and logistics staff.

#NHAI Highway NOC & Zoning Legal Due Diligence

Commercial development along National Highways requires explicit Access Permission and NOC from NHAI (National Highways Authority of India) for service road connections and deceleration lanes.

Verify DTCP Commercial/Industrial land use classification and confirm that the survey plot is free from National Highway land widening reservations.

Key Verification Checklist

  • Verify NHAI service road access permission & setback norms.
  • Check DTCP Commercial / Industrial zoning approval.
  • Audit 30-year Encumbrance Certificate for clear commercial title.
  • Verify online Patta mutation and boundary survey markers.

Q: Is NHAI NOC mandatory for commercial construction on national highways?

A: Yes, any commercial entry or service road connection to a National Highway requires official NHAI clearance.
